About Joseph F. Canterbury, Jr.
Joseph F. Canterbury, Jr. is a lawyer based in Dallas, TX and has been recognized in The Best Lawyers in America® since 2003. Joseph F. Canterbury, Jr. is recognized in the following practice area:
- Dallas, Texas
- Construction Law
Current Firm: Canterbury PC
Education: Southern Methodist University, J.D., graduated 1966
Location: Dallas, TX
